Subject: Cursor pagination live in Lanternfish API v2.4

Team,

The public REST API now defaults to cursor-based pagination on all list endpoints. Offset parameters remain accepted until the v3 cutover but emit a deprecation header. Page size caps at 100; requests above that are clamped, not rejected. Please verify your integration tests against staging before Thursday's freeze. The token for this release build is below.

session token of tajef-bageg = htk21_5d90d574934f3ccae6437

## Formula sandbox tuning

User-supplied formulas in Gridmoor execute inside a restricted interpreter with hard ceilings on time, memory, and call depth. Reviewers should confirm any change to these ceilings is justified in the PR description, since raising them widens the abuse surface. Defaults were chosen from production traces. The current limits are as follows.

limits module of tafog-fawip:
WEIGHTS = {
    "julix": 57,
    "lamys": 992,
    "kasvan": 209,
    "quenok": 750,
    "alddor": 259,
    "oliath": 1009,
    "wenix": 815,
}

To: Dispatch desk
Subject: Backup tape run — tonight

Shift lead — the weekly off-site tapes from the Brackwell server room go out tonight, not Friday. Two locked grey cases, already logged. Courier from Stonerill Secure arrives 21:00 at dock B. Cases stay sealed; no inspection at the dock. Sign the custody slip yourself, not a temp. Courier follows the hand-over instruction below.

handover note for yagef-bagep: the drudor pelius courier leaves the kasdor zorvan norir ledger at gate 8016 under passcode 755406

Dear all, please find attached the Q2 gross-margin review for the Copperfield product family. Margin declined 1.9 points, driven chiefly by freight costs on the Larkspur line and discounting in the Netherby territory. Corrective measures are detailed in sections three and four. The confidential note below sets out our intended next steps.

confidential, kagup-bafog: Fraaxax Group is in early talks to buy Soroxox Group for about $343.8 million. The Olidor launch date is June 14, and nothing goes to the press before then. Legal wants the Aldmirek Logistics term sheet signed before July 23.